Publisher Description:

When Marcie Ducasse, newly promoted associate editor of Roaming New England magazine, gets a call from Steve Rostow, an old college friend, telling her that the ghost of a girl killed twenty years ago on the night of her senior prom has returned seeking vengeance, she knows this is the right material for her "Weird Happenings" column.

As Marcie and Steve investigate further they find that one of the richest men in the town of Arbella, Connecticut, who was a suspect in the girl's murder, is trying to hush up the ghost s attacks. He would also like to keep Marcie and Steve from writing their story in order to protect his own political ambitions. As the attacks reach a murderous crescendo, it becomes clear that they can no longer be concealed, and Marcie and Steve are forced to unearth events that happened twenty years before, in order to understand who killed the girl on the night of her prom and who--or what--has returned to avenge her.


Contributor Bio(s): Ebisch, Glen: -

Glen Ebisch has a doctorate in Philosophy and is a professor at a local college. He has been writing fiction for the past fifteen years, and has had several mysteries for young people published. His interests include yoga, weightlifting, gardening, and reading. He and his wife, who is an avid quilter, live in western Massachusetts by the foothills of the Berkshires.
